Understanding Bulk Copy Paper
Bulk copy paper describes paper sold in big amounts, making it an economical choice for companies with high printing demands. It is commonly offered in various weights, brightness levels, and finishes, permitting consumers to choose the most appropriate paper for their specific applications.
Secret Specifications
Before diving into the kinds of bulk copy paper available, it is vital to comprehend some crucial specifications:
| Specification | Description |
|---|---|
| Weight | Measured in grams per square meter (GSM) or pounds (pounds). Common weights for copy paper variety from 20 lb to 32 pound. |
| Brightness | Rated on a scale from 1 to 100, with higher numbers indicating brighter white paper. |
| Complete | Can be smooth, textured, or laid. A smooth finish is ideal for high-quality printing, while a textured surface includes an unique touch to discussions. |
| Size | Typical sizes consist of Letter (8.5 x 11 inches), Legal (8.5 x 14 inches), and A4 (210 x 297 mm). |
Types of Bulk Copy Paper
When it comes to bulk copy paper, there are a number of types suited for different purposes:
1. Requirement Copy Paper
Basic copy paper is a flexible choice utilized for everyday printing tasks. It usually comes in weights of 20 lb to 24 lb and works well in most printers and copiers.
Best for: Routine printing, documents, and internal memos.
2. Premium Copy Paper
Premium copy paper usually weighs in between 24 pound and 32 pound and includes a greater brightness level. This type of paper is particularly designed for top quality printing and can enhance the look of images and text.
Best for: Presentations, marketing materials, and professional reports.
3. Image Copy Paper
This type of paper is specially formulated for printing images and images, with a shiny finish that enhances visual quality. Photo copy paper might come in various weights however is typically much heavier than standard copy paper.
Best for: Photographs, sales brochures, and premium graphics.
4. Recycled Copy Paper
Recycled copy paper is made from post-consumer waste and is an eco-friendly alternative. It is readily available in various weights and brightness levels, supplying a sustainable choice without compromising quality.
Best for: Environmentally conscious organizations and businesses.
5. Specialty Paper
Specialized paper consists of choices like colored paper, cardstock, and paper with special textures or surfaces. These documents can be used for innovative jobs, invites, and professional presentations, adding flair and character.
Best for: Creative tasks, invites, and professional presentations.
Aspects to Consider When Buying Bulk Copy Paper
Buying bulk copy paper can be overwhelming due to the sheer amount of alternatives readily available. Here are some essential elements to think about that will assist simplify the decision-making procedure:
1. Use Needs
Recognize the primary purpose of the paper. Will it be used mainly for internal files, top quality prints, or imaginative projects? Knowing the intended usage will assist narrow down the choices.
2. Printer Compatibility
Before picking paper, inspect the specifications of your printer or copier. Certain kinds of paper, such as heavier stock or photo paper, may not be suitable with all printers.
3. Budget
Set a clear spending plan for your bulk paper purchase. While it can be appealing to pick the most inexpensive choice, think about the quality and efficiency to avoid future reprints and waste.
4. Ecological Impact
If your company positions a premium on sustainability, think about recycled choices. Lots of recycled papers keep high-quality performance and contribute positively to the environment.
5. Provider Reputation
Purchase from trustworthy providers to ensure consistency and quality. Research client reviews and reviews to pick a reliable source for your bulk copy paper requires.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1: What is the difference in between 20 lb and 24 pound copy paper?
A: The weight indicates the thickness and strength of the paper. 24 pound paper is heavier and generally provides much better print quality and toughness than 20 pound paper.
Q2: Can I use photo paper in a basic printer?
A: Yes, the majority of standard printers can manage photo paper, however ensure you pick the correct settings on your printer for ideal outcomes.
Q3: How much paper do I require for my workplace?
A: The amount of paper required differs based upon your printing frequency and the size of your office. An average little workplace may utilize around 5-10 reams (500 sheets per ream) per month.
Q4: Is recycled copy paper as good as non-recycled paper?
A: High-quality recycled copy documents can carry out equally well as non-recycled papers and are often equivalent in print quality.
Q5: What is the finest brightness level for copy paper?
A: A brightness level in between 90 and 100 is ideal for top quality printing, especially for expert documents and discussions.
